Unlocking Efficiency: The Power of RFID Technology

In today's fast-paced environment, efficiency is paramount. Businesses across industries are constantly seeking ways to streamline operations and optimize processes. One technology that has emerged as a powerful solution for enhancing efficiency is RFID, or Radio-Frequency Identification. RFID involves the use of electromagnetic fields to automatically identify and track objects. By utilizing unique tags, RFID systems can accurately track tagged items in real time, providing valuable data that can be used to improve supply chain management, inventory optimization, and even customer satisfaction.

Secure and Verifiable: RFID for Asset Management

In today's dynamic business landscape, enhancing asset management is paramount. Radio-frequency identification (RFID) technology provides a cutting-edge solution for businesses to effectively track and manage their assets throughout their lifecycle. RFID tags are attached to individual assets, broadcasting unique identification codes when read by an RFID reader. This instantaneous tracking capability empowers organizations to observe asset location, status, and movement with unparalleled accuracy.

RFID and Real-Time Inventory Tracking

Inventory management is vital for businesses of all scales. Having a clear understanding of your stock levels, position, and movement is fundamental to enhancing operations and meeting customer demands. RFID technology provides a powerful solution for achieving real-time inventory visibility, offering numerous advantages. By adopting RFID tags and readers, businesses can trace items throughout their entire lifecycle, from receiving to dispatch.

Real-time data allows for instantaneous updates on stock levels, revealing potential gaps before they affect operations. Additionally, RFID systems can automate inventory assessment, reducing manual effort. This improves accuracy and productivity, ultimately leading to cost savings and improved customer service.
